Transaction 283109c77f673d2724b26ba456d0a300987e821af2c68068b089a2c7ecf66c80

1 Input
2 Outputs
  • 283109c77f673d2724b26ba456d0a300987e821af2c68068b089a2c7ecf66c80:0
  • value  523177
    address  37q22YkfcpqkZWjdPeiRdy5Q6geWzb3mjA
  • 283109c77f673d2724b26ba456d0a300987e821af2c68068b089a2c7ecf66c80:1
  • value  634473
    address  33jC6SqoQgnE57weL6tfewCRTXQsLTiuVo